PPL (NYSE:PPL -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Thursday, July 31st. The utilities provider reported $0.32 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$0.37 by ($0.05). PPL had a net margin of 11.22% and a return on equity of 8.81%. The business had revenue of $2.03 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.99 billion. During the same period last year, the business posted $0.38 EPS.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 7.7%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that PPL Corporation will post 1.83 EPS for the current fiscal year.
PPL Dividend Announcement
The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, July 1st.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, June 10th were given a $0.2725 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Tuesday, June 10th. This represents a $1.09 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.0%. PPL's payout ratio is presently 81.34%.

PPL Corporation, an energy company, focuses on providing electricity and natural gas to approximately 3.6 million customers in the United States. It operates through three segments: Kentucky Regulated, Pennsylvania Regulated, and Rhode Island Regulated. The company delivers electricity to customers in Pennsylvania, Kentucky, Virginia, and Rhode Island; delivers natural gas to customers in Kentucky and Rhode Island; and generates electricity from power plants in Kentucky.
